/**
 * @ingroup breakpoint
 *
 * Inserts a breakpoint instruction (or equivalent system call) into
 * the code for selected machines.  When an NS_ASSERT cannot verify
 * its condition, this macro is used. Falls back to calling
 * ns3::BreakpointFallback() for architectures where breakpoint assembly
 * instructions are not supported.
 */
#if (defined(__i386__) || defined(__amd64__) || defined(__x86_64__)) && defined(__GNUC__) &&       \
    __GNUC__ >= 2
#define NS_BREAKPOINT()                                                                            \
    do                                                                                             \
    {                                                                                              \
        __asm__ __volatile__("int $03");                                                           \
    } while (false)
#elif defined(_MSC_VER) && defined(_M_IX86)
#define NS_BREAKPOINT()                                                                            \
    do                                                                                             \
    {                                                                                              \
        __asm int 3h                                                                               \
    } while (false)
#elif defined(__alpha__) && !defined(__osf__) && defined(__GNUC__) && __GNUC__ >= 2
#define NS_BREAKPOINT()                                                                            \
    do                                                                                             \
    {                                                                                              \
        __asm__ __volatile__("bpt");                                                               \
    } while (false)
#else /* !__i386__ && !__alpha__ */
#define NS_BREAKPOINT() ns3::BreakpointFallback()
#endif

/**
 * @ingroup breakpoint
 *
 * @brief fallback breakpoint function
 *
 * This function is used by the NS_BREAKPOINT() macro as a fallback
 * for when breakpoint assembly instructions are not available.  It
 * attempts to halt program execution either by a raising SIGTRAP, on
 * unix systems, or by dereferencing a null pointer.
 *
 * Normally you should not call this function directly.
 */
void BreakpointFallback();
